We are also committed to supporting work–life balance, offering flexibility and resources to help our team members grow their careers while maintaining fulfilling personal lives.If you are looking for a career where you can grow, contribute, and be part of a firm that values both excellence and community, PKF O’Connor Davies is the place for you!The Business Development Managing Director or Partner is a senior growth leader responsible for originating new business, expanding strategic relationships, and driving revenue growth across the Firm’s targeted industry segments.This individual will lead all aspects of the business development lifecycle, including strategic prospect identification, direct outreach, relationship development, opportunity qualification, pursuit strategy, proposal development, and closing new business. The Managing Director or Partner will work closely with Firm leadership, Partners, industry leaders, and service-line leaders to identify opportunities and develop coordinated strategies to grow the Firm’s market presence and client base.The successful candidate will bring a demonstrated track record of originating, developing, and closing significant business opportunities within targeted industries, supported by an established network of senior executives, business owners, financial sponsors, and centers of influence. This individual will serve as a highly credible and visible representative of the Firm in the marketplace, with the ability to build and maintain trusted relationships with C-suite executives and other key decision-makers. The ideal candidate will leverage these relationships, along with a strong understanding of industry dynamics and client needs, to identify opportunities, generate new business, and drive sustainable revenue growth for the Firm.As an enterprise-level business development leader, the Managing Director or Partner will represent the full breadth of the Firm’s capabilities rather than a single service line and will connect prospective and existing clients with the appropriate professionals and solutions across the organization.Key Responsibilities:Identify and pursue new business opportunities through prospecting, networking, referrals, and market outreach.Build and maintain a strong pipeline of qualified prospects and opportunities.Develop and execute business development strategies aligned with firm growth priorities.Prospect for new Audit, Tax, and Advisory opportunities across target industries and markets.Lead the full sales cycle from initial outreach and qualification through proposal, negotiation, contracting, and close.Develop targeted account plans and go-to-market strategies for priority prospects and market segments.Lead proposal strategy, positioning, and win themes for new business opportunities.Collaborate with Audit, Tax, and Advisory leaders to identify opportunities and bring the appropriate services to prospective clients.Identify cross-selling opportunities across the firm’s service offerings.Develop and deliver presentations, proposals, and other sales materials for prospective clients.Leverage professional associations, industry organizations, referral sources, and community networks to generate leads and increase market visibility.Plan and execute seminars, conferences, webcasts, and other events designed to generate new business opportunities.Support marketing and outbound campaigns designed to increase brand awareness and generate qualified leads.Track business development activity, pipeline progression, and next steps to maintain consistent sales momentum.Develop opportunities across private companies, private equity, financial services, manufacturing, technology, real estate, healthcare, and other middle-market sectors.Qualifications:Bachelor’s degree required; advanced degree or relevant professional credentials preferred.10+ years of progressive business development, sales, or client relationship experience, with a demonstrated track record of successfully originating and closing new business within accounting, consulting, financial services, or another professional services environment.Proven success selling complex, relationship-driven professional services — not products — to middle-market and larger organizations.Demonstrated history of generating meaningful new revenue through proactive prospecting, relationship development, referrals, networking, and centers of influence.Established and transferable network of senior executives, business owners, private equity professionals, bankers, attorneys, wealth advisors, consultants, and other centers of influence that can be leveraged to identify and develop new business opportunities.Strong relationships and demonstrated experience working with C-suite executives and other senior-level decision-makers within the middle market.Proven ability to identify, cultivate, and convert prospective relationships into qualified opportunities and long-term client relationships.Demonstrated experience leading complex, consultative sales processes involving multiple stakeholders, service professionals, and decision-makers, primarily at the C-suite and executive level.Ability to understand a prospective client’s business objectives, challenges, and needs and effectively connect those needs to the Firm’s appropriate services and subject-matter experts.Demonstrated ability to represent and sell a broad portfolio of professional services across multiple service lines rather than focusing exclusively on a single offering.Strong understanding of the middle-market business environment and the issues affecting privately held companies, public companies, private equity-backed organizations, entrepreneurs, and business owners.Ability to develop and execute strategic account and territory plans, including prospect identification, prioritization, relationship mapping, pursuit strategies, and pipeline development.Proven ability to build, manage, and advance a robust pipeline of qualified opportunities while maintaining disciplined follow-up throughout lengthy and complex sales cycles.Strong business acumen and commercial judgment, with the ability to assess the quality, strategic value, revenue potential, and likelihood of success of prospective opportunities.Demonstrated ability to collaborate effectively with Partners, Principals, practice leaders, industry leaders, and subject-matter experts to develop and execute coordinated pursuit strategies.Experience identifying opportunities to cross-sell and introduce additional services to existing clients and prospects.Strong market presence with demonstrated involvement in relevant industry associations, professional organizations, networking groups, conferences, and business communities.Exceptional executive presence and the ability to credibly represent the Firm with senior executives, business owners, referral sources, and other influential members of the business community.Excellent relationship-building, influencing, negotiation, presentation, and communication skills.Highly motivated, entrepreneurial, self-disciplined, and results-oriented, with a strong sense of ownership and accountability for business development and revenue goals.Demonstrated ability to work independently while successfully navigating and collaborating within a highly matrixed, partnership-driven professional services organization.Strong organizational and time-management skills, with the ability to prioritize multiple prospects, pursuits, relationships, and internal stakeholders simultaneously.Ability to thrive in a fast-paced, dynamic environment and adapt business development strategies in response to changing market conditions and Firm priorities.Proficiency with CRM systems and a commitment to maintaining accurate and timely pipeline, prospect, and business development activity.The compensation for this position ranges from $150,000 - $235,000. Actual compensation will be dependent upon the specific role, office location as well as the individual’s qualifications, experience, skills, and certifications.
